What is an End of Task (EOT) sign-off?

Explanation:
End of Task sign-off is the formal closure that the entire PQS has been completed. It signals that you have demonstrated all required tasks to standard and that your PQS record can be marked finished. This is the final credentialing milestone, not a sign-off for just one task, a small block of tasks, or knowledge items alone. Only when every task in the PQS has been completed and verified does the End of Task sign-off indicate the overall qualification is complete.
